7 Epic Ways To Rename Your Fantasy Football Team
1. Go for Wordplay
Wordplay is a timeless classic in team naming. It involves using puns, double meanings, and clever turns of phrase to create a unique and engaging name. For example, "The Running Backwards" or "The Quarter-Backward." Wordplay team names can be both funny and clever, making them a popular choice among fantasy football enthusiasts.
2. Incorporate Your Favorite Players
Including your favorite players in your team name can be a great way to pay tribute and show your appreciation for their skills. For instance, "Brady's Bunch" or "Tom Terrific's Team." This approach can also help to create a sense of community and shared passion among team members.
3. Use Puns and Jokes
Puns and jokes are a staple of team naming, and for good reason. They're often funny, memorable, and can even create a sense of camaraderie among team members. For example, "The Punt-ditians" or "The Sacked and Confused." Puns and jokes can add a lighthearted touch to your team name and make it more engaging.
4. Create a Theme
Creating a theme for your team name can help to define your team's identity and values. This can include anything from a favorite sports team to a cultural or historical reference. For example, "The Roman Empire" or "The Football Frenzy." Themes can add depth and complexity to your team name, making it more meaningful and memorable.
5. Go for Alliteration
Alliteration is a powerful tool in team naming, making your name more engaging and memorable. For instance, "The Quarterback Kings" or "The Running Ramblers." Alliteration can create a sense of rhythm and flow, making your team name more catchy and effective.
6. Use Pop Culture References
Pop culture references are a great way to add a touch of creativity and originality to your team name. For example, "The Avengers of the Gridiron" or "The Hunger Games of Fantasy Football." Pop culture references can make your team name more relatable and engaging, especially among fans of the referenced franchise.
7. Create a Storyline
Creating a storyline for your team name can help to define your team's identity and values. This can include a narrative, a theme, or even a character. For example, "The Quest for the Perfect Game" or "The Rise of the Underdog." Storylines can add depth and complexity to your team name, making it more memorable and engaging.
